HSE public consultation: chemicals legislative reform

Deadline for responses: 18 August 2025, 11:59pm.

HSE is consulting on proposals for changes to HSE-led chemicals policy.

The consultation seeks your views on:

  • GB Biocidal Products Regulation (GB BPR)
  • GB Classification, Labelling and Packaging of substances and mixtures (GB CLP)
  • the export and import of hazardous chemicals – GB Prior Informed Consent (GB PIC)


The consultation is in direct support of a key commitment made by the Prime Minister as part of the government’s policy paper which is an action plan that forms part of the broader government mission to kickstart economic growth.

These proposed changes to the HSE-led areas of the chemicals framework should result in reducing costs to business. HSE will need to make these changes through an appropriate legislative route that may require new legislative powers.

The government recognises that the operation of distinct CLP regimes in Northern Ireland and Great Britain has the potential to impact on the operation of the UK internal market.

HSE is interested in your views on the recent revisions to EU CLP, their potential impact on the UK’s internal market and the merits of applying a consistent CLP regime across the UK.
